### Step 4: Warm the tax-rate lookup cache

Before routing traffic to the new Ledgewick nodes, run taxcache warm --region all to preload current jurisdiction rates from the Ardmont rate service. Expect roughly four minutes. Confirm hit rates exceed 95% on the Pellview dashboard. Then push the cache manifest to production, authenticating with the deploy key below.

signing key of fajop-tahop = bky9_qdL6xeDv7

Leadership Review Briefing — Revised Commission Scheme

Finance folks: quick primer before Thursday. The new Davenmoor scheme swaps flat 5% commission for tiered rates tied to margin, not revenue. Modelling shows top performers gain, discount-heavy reps lose about 9%. Payout timing moves to quarterly, easing cash swings. Expect noise from the Westlake region. We'll present sensitivity scenarios at the review. The scheme's link to next year's growth targets is outlined below.

management briefing: Project Ulavan slips by two quarters because of the staffing delay.

Service account: gpuprof-release. Owns the Memtrawl profiling agents on the Orrickvale GPU fleet. Release manager duties: bump the agent version in the manifest, confirm snapshot uploads resume within five minutes, and close the rollout checklist. Do not reuse this account for ad-hoc profiling; it is rate-limited per node. Scopes: snapshot:write, fleet:read. Rotation is tied to each minor release. The account authenticates to the internal snapshot ingest service with the key below.

service key, fawip-bajef: kto11_Qt5wZK9vdNC

## Migrating to Hermetic Builds

Plugins targeting Larkstone 4.x must declare all toolchain dependencies in a manifest; ambient compilers are no longer detected. Run `larkstone vendor verify` to confirm your sandbox resolves cleanly before submitting. Most migrations take under an hour. If your plugin needs a dependency not yet mirrored, request it from the build-infrastructure team.

escalation mailbox, bafog-fafog: ulador@paliqlabs.internal